NutriDesi generates customised Indian diet plans for four core goals: weight loss, lean muscle gain, PCOD / PCOS management and type-2 diabetes control. Every plan is built around food that's actually cooked in Indian kitchens — dal-chawal, sabzi-roti, paneer bhurji, idli-sambar, poha, khichdi, rajma, chana and curd — with calorie and protein targets calibrated to your body weight, activity level and goal. Plans can be vegetarian, vegan, eggetarian or non-vegetarian, and we automatically swap in millets (ragi, bajra, jowar), oats and besan for diabetic and PCOD users to keep the glycemic load low. For women managing PCOD / PCOS and insulin resistance
A low-glycemic, anti-inflammatory plan that swaps refined wheat and white rice for millets, oats and besan. Higher in protein and healthy fats to support hormonal balance and steady weight loss.
Breakfast · 350 kcal
Vegetable oats upma + boiled egg + cinnamon tea
Mid-morning · 120 kcal
1 small bowl papaya + flax seeds
Lunch · 480 kcal
1 jowar roti + palak paneer + curd + salad
Evening · 150 kcal
Roasted makhana + green tea
Dinner · 380 kcal
Moong dal cheela + sautéed veggies + buttermilk
Diabetic-Friendly Indian Plan
1,700 kcal • Stable blood sugar
For type-2 diabetics targeting HbA1c control
Built around low-GI grains (bajra, ragi, jowar), high-fibre dals and bitter vegetables like methi and karela. Spaced into 5 small meals to prevent sugar spikes — no white rice, no sugary chai.
Breakfast · 330 kcal
2 methi-besan cheelas + mint chutney + unsweetened tea
